Which college should I go for? My profile: 10th-95%, 12th-91% and UG-82% till now. I am a final year student.

In CAT, I've got 89 percentile. Can someone help in deciding which college should I consider for PGDM? Anywhere in India is fine.

Hi Sreerag, talking about colleges for a score around 89 in CAT you could target, IMI, IMT, KJ SIMSR, FORE, GIM, Great Lakes etc. Provided you have filled the college forms separately for the above-mentioned colleges. Even NMIMS and SIBM, Pune are good options but you need to give NMAT and SNAP exam

Hi You may apply for Great Lakes Institute of Management. If you have work experience of less than 2 years then you are eligible for PGDM programme otherwise you should apply for PGPM programme here. All the best!
